Denny Eckrich captures Deery opener, $5,555

WEST BURLINGTON, Iowa (April 6) – The lucrative season opener on the 2013 Deery Brothers Summer Series belongs to Denny Eckrich.

The Tiffin, Iowa, driver battled younger brother Andy much of the way before winning Saturday’s Brenton Slocum Memorial 50 at 34 Raceway. The IMCA Late Model tour victory paid $5,555 as he topped reigning series champion Jeff Aikey of Waterloo, Iowa, and 21st-starting Brian Harris of Davenport, Iowa. | Slideshow

Andy Eckrich of Iowa City and Jason Utter of Columbus Junction, Iowa, completed the top five as 46 cars enter the 27th annual series opener.

Andy Eckrich started on the pole with Denny lined up right behind him for the initial green. With Andy running on top and Denny on the bottom, both caught up with the back of the field by lap 11 and continued their side-by-side, bumper-to-bumper tussle.

Denny was briefly in front on lap 19 and took over that position for good four lead changes later. Aikey, now in pursuit of his eighth career series title, moved into second on lap 39 and began to reel in the leader.

The 50-lapper came to an end before he could complete that quest, however, and Aikey finished two lengths off the pace.

Notes: Denny Eckrich's Barry Wright Race Car is sponsored by Precision Performance, Mac Tools and Grove Automotive. ...The victory was the series career third for Eckrich. ... He also took home the $538 Honus Bonus for leading lap 38. ... Both the top two finishers had their cylinder heads removed during postrace tech inspection and passed with flying colors. ... Tom Darbyshire of Morning Sun, Iowa, raced from 20th to third before getting into the backstretch wall on lap 33. ... Aikey won the $250 Sunoco Race Fuels drawing while Harris earned the $555 hard charger prize for his 21st-to-third run. ... Among drivers failing to make the feature lineup: Curt Martin, Rob Moss, Joe Ross, Brandon Queen, Rick Wendling, Tyler Bruening, Chuck Hanna, Larry Harris, Curt Schroeder, Jay Johnson, Ray Guss Jr., Travis Denning, Sam Halstead, Jay Chenoweth, Mike Garland, Rob Toland, Kelly Pestka and Shawn Mulvany. ... A pair of $3,000 to win shows are next for the series April 13 at West Liberty (Iowa) Raceway and April 14 at Dubuque (Iowa) Speedway, an event postponed nine days.

Brenton Slocum Memorial: (1) Denny Eckrich, (2) Jeff Aikey, (3) Brian Harris, (4) Andy Eckrich, (5) Jason Utter, (6) Colby Springsteen, (7) Jeremiah Hurst, (8) Justin Kay, (9) Tom Goble, (10) Joel Callahan, (11) Nate Beuseling, (12) Darrel DeFrance, (13) Spencer Diercks, (14) Jeff Mitrisin, (15) Matt Strassheim, (16) Tom Darbyshire, (17) Dan Shelliam, (18) Mike Murphy Jr., (19) Ron Klein, (20) Dean Wagner, (21) Todd Malmstrom, (22) Luke Goedert, (23) Travis Smock, (24) Jon Merfeld. Heat race winners (among 46 cars): Diercks, Utter, Denny Eckrich, Shelliam, Mitrisin. Consolation winners: Murphy, Callahan. Provisional starter: Kay.
